Ingredients

8 oz Dates chopped, pitted
1 cup Orange juice
2 cups All-purpose flour
3 tsp Baking powder
¾ tsp Cinnamon
½ tsp Salt
¾ cup Granulated sugar
2 Large eggs
4 tbsp Butter melted

This Orange Date Bread gives me the opportunity to bake with one of my favorite dried fruits: dates! I absolutely adore dates. Sweet and sticky and moist, they are increasingly used as a natural sugar substitute in cakes and sweet treats. Soaking dried dates in liquid can help to boost their moisture and flavor. If you like an added crunch, you could add some pecan nuts or walnuts to the batter before baking.

This orange date bread recipe is so easy to make too. Start by heating orange juice in a saucepan. Remove from the heat once the juice simmers and stir in dates. Leave to rest until cool. Meanwhile, add the dry ingredients to a mixing bowl. Once cool, add beaten eggs to the orange and date mixture and combine with the dry ingredients. Bake in the oven and enjoy while still warm!

Steps to make Orange Date Bread

1

Heat the oven and prepare a pan

5

Preheat the oven to 350 °F. Lightly grease and flour a 9x5x3-inch loaf pan.

2

Soak dates in orange juice

25

Bring 1 cup of orange juice to a simmer in a saucepan. Once simmering, remove the pan from the heat and stir in 8 ounces of dates. Let the dates stand in the orange juice for about 25 minutes, until cooled.

3

Mix dry ingredients

2

Add 2 cups of flour, 3 teaspoons of baking powder, ¾ teaspoon of cinnamon, ½ a teaspoon of salt and ¾ cup of granulated sugar to a large mixing bowl. Stir to combine.

4

Beat eggs

1

Beat 2 large eggs.

5

Add eggs and butter to dates

1

Add beaten eggs to the cooled orange and date mixture along with 4 tablespoons of melted butter.

6

Mix dry and wet ingredients

3

Pour the date mixture into the dry ingredients and mix until well blended. Transfer the date bread batter to the prepared loaf pan.

7

Bake

50

Bake in the oven for 40-50 minutes until the top of the cake is browned. A toothpick inserted in the center should come out clean.

8

Serve

1

Serve large slices of this bread while it’s still slightly warm.
